How Outpatient Drug Rehab Works in Burnt Prairie, Illinois

If you have been grappling with an extreme substance use disorder and addiction, outpatient alcohol and drug rehab might not prove to be enough for you. Before you look for treatment for your addiction, you must first go through detox to rid your body completely of the substances you were abusing.

After the detox stage, the outpatient addiction treatment will start the official work of therapy and recovery. In fact, these programs work best if you have already completed another form of care - such as a participating in an inpatient alcohol and drug treatment facility. You should also be considered medically stable enough that you can easily pursue treatment and recovery by yourself.

When you enroll in an outpatient drug and alcohol rehab in Burnt Prairie, the following services will be provided every week:

  • Family therapy sessions
  • Group therapy and individual meetings for support and encouragement
  • One-on-one therapy session
  • Organization and management of prescribed medications for co-occurring disorders
  • Diet Management
  • One on one therapy sessions with licensed treatment counselors
  • Exercise related therapy
  • Relapse Prevention Skills
  • Sober living housing, where required

Since outpatient rehab does not require that you reside inside the center, it means that you might need to dedicate yourself to sobriety so that the program proves fruitful in the long run. You should also desire sobriety and abstain from drugs without any monitoring or care.

As long as your environment is conducive to your recovery, you might find that outp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ation is the best option. This is because you will get support and care at home so that you can continue focusing on beating your addiction - with none of the pitfalls you may have run into in the past.
